"Stay with bowel obstruction and Crohn's disease"

About: Royal Bournemouth General Hospital

Emergency admission to Bournemouth hospital with severe bowel obstruction.

Stayed in for 8 days in wards 16 and 18.

First time ever in hospital and with young family was a very scary experience. All staff and care was excellent. Very friendly always smiling and supportive. Doctors were great and helpful. I think with all bowel complications all not straight forward and now being treated as outpatient.

The staff in this hospital does an amazing job, they are understaffed and under paid. Yet the still provide outstanding care.

They deserve more as no way I could provide that level of care and that is from the heart.
